About The Position

Connor Co. is seeking a career-minded individual for a long-term Counter Sales position in Urbana, IL. This role involves entering sales orders, merchandising products, assisting customers with selections, and managing warehouse operations including loading/unloading trucks, processing inbound materials, and maintaining a clean and safe work environment. The ideal candidate will be detail-oriented, possess strong communication and organizational skills, and be able to work independently under deadlines.

Responsibilities

  • Enter sales orders into the Eclipse system and pick customer order tickets.
  • Merchandise and stock products on displays and in self-service areas.
  • Select the correct products or assist customers in making product selections.
  • Emphasize product features based on customers' needs and technical knowledge of product capabilities and limitations.
  • Answer customers' questions about products, prices, availability, and credit terms.
  • Efficient and effective loading and unloading of trucks.
  • Inspect materials according to instructions and report damaged goods.
  • Process inbound materials to the warehouse.
  • Compare quantities shown on packing slip or manifests with actual items received.
  • Sort and place materials or items on racks, shelves, or in bins according to sequences such as size, type, style, color, or product code.
  • Ensure materials are placed in the designated areas within the warehouse.
  • Stack skids or pallets in designated areas.
  • Clean up and dispose of scrap bracing, cardboard, and strapping and place in proper containers or designated areas.
  • Maintain a safe and clean work environment by keeping racks, shelves, pallet area, workstations, and counter area neat; maintaining clean shipping supply area; complying with procedures, rules, and regulations.
  • General housekeeping: sweeping, mopping, dusting, empty trash.
  • Perform other duties as requested.
